Web1. Corn. Corn is commonly used in crop rotations for potatoes and can help replenish the soil after planting potatoes. Additionally, corn is a non-host crop for wireworms and is a natural way of preventing future infestations. This is one of the best crops to include in your potato rotations. WebCrop rotation is beneficial for four main reasons: (1) Plants that fix nitrogen, such as peas and other legumes, improve soil quality for future vegetables planted in the same bed. (2) Alternating shallow-rooted and deep-rooted plants in a given area draws nutrients from the soil at varying depths.
